These wine racks are very cool looking. However, they are held together with screws that go through the spacer tubes, and many of the screws were loose. I ordered three of these racks, and all of them needed to have a bunch of screws tightened. Only one of the racks could be thoroughly tightened; the other two had screws that just spun in their tubes, either because they were stripped or because the holes in the wood were not deep enough for the screws to catch the threads in the tube. Also, the finish on the racks was pretty uneven and had lines rubbed in it from the corrugated cardboard of the box. Only one rack had lines that wouldn't rub out, so I turned that side to the wall.
Anyway, I kept the racks, because they were sturdy enough, even without a few screws holding. But be aware, some of the screws stuck out on the bottom (holes in the wood were uneven depth, so some screws are recessed, and some not so much). So if you put the rack on a delicate surface, it may leave scratches.
In short, the racks aren't the kind of quality you expect for that price, but they look interesting enough that I was willing to overlook that.
